textwatcher

    0熱度

    1回答

    在我的應用程序中,用戶可以在MultiAutoComplete中輸入#,服務器的建議將會在#之後顯示。例如: 用戶類型#foo,服務器返回MultiAutoComplete文本,如#food#football。 現在一切正常,如果光標位於文本的末尾。正確的方法是獲取最後一個詞,檢測它是否以#開頭並將其發送到服務器。當用戶正在編輯文本並將光標設置在中間某處時,問題就開始了。 TextWatcher只

    1熱度

    2回答

    我想格式化輸入,格式爲EditText中的數字格式。格式爲01-133134-124。我想第一個-後2號然後下一個破折號後6個數字。我試過,但每當我按下刪除/退格,因爲輸入錯誤格式停止工作,沒有破折號輸入2號或6號後輸入。這裏是代碼如下。Enrollement是EditText字段。 格式: 2digitnumber-6dignumber-3dignumber Enrollement.addTex

    0熱度

    2回答

    我使用edittext自定義列表視圖。我正在使用textwatcher,並嘗試在edittext中的文本類型大於零時添加新行。 但無論我輸入它不顯示在我的編輯文本。 public View getView(int position,View view,ViewGroup parent) { final int c = position; LayoutInflater inf

    -1熱度

    1回答

    我想一個TextWatcher方法添加到通過導航抽屜裝一個片段: @Override public void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); if (getArguments() != null) { mParam1 = getArgu

    -1熱度

    2回答

    我正在使用Text Watcher類在每四個字符後插入連字符( - )。我也用OnKeyListener來檢查是否按下了BackSpace或Delete鍵。但按退格鍵後,我無法刪除連字符。我搜索了很多,發現這不適用於軟鍵盤。我是對的還是有解決這個問題的。 感謝

    0熱度

    1回答

    我試圖獲得與here中顯示的結果相同的結果。但沒有圖像設置。此外,我必須點擊每個edittext才能輸入一個數字。當輸入前一個(maxLength = 1)時,我希望光標移動到下一個編輯文本。 「星號1」是帶星號的圖像,「空號碼」是沒有星號的圖像。如果有人能告訴我我做錯了什麼,那將會非常有幫助。 activity_main <LinearLayout xmlns:android="ht

    1熱度

    1回答

    我希望我的應用程序執行的是計算平均值並將其顯示在TextView中。 我有兩個按鈕(button0和button1)和六個TextViews的佈局。當我按下其中一個按鈕時,我的應用程序將獲得按下的點擊次數以及與另一個按鈕相同的次數。而且它還可以獲得按下兩個按鈕的總點擊次數。因此,如果我按點擊次數來分按鈕0,按下總點擊次數,則按下兩個按鈕,然後將其乘以100,得到按下該按鈕的百分比點擊次數。 所以這

    0熱度

    1回答

    我需要幫助。我不知道如何爲可能的EditText字段創建TextWatcher。我想這樣做:如果我在第一個字段中輸入文本,我想爲其他字段計算值。四個字段是可編輯的,所以如果我把值放在一個EditText中,它會改變其他值,並且會導致循環和Stackoverflowerror。 它的源代碼: package com.example.hp.ptcalculator; import android.

    2熱度

    2回答

    如何在EditText的末尾添加問號(?)作爲用戶類型。每一個textchanged問號都應該保留在edittext的末尾,就像它在Quora中發生的一樣。我正在使用textwatcher來更改文本並在最後放置問號,但我沒有得到確切的邏輯。 textWatcher = new TextWatcher() { @Override public void beforeTextC

    0熱度

    1回答

    是否有任何方法可以使EditText作爲部分不可編輯的背景顏色。類似下面的圖片 這裏光線暗的文本是不可編輯和其他人編輯。 我已經嘗試TextWatcher像下面的一些文字吐痰正則表達式(split("\\."))的幫助。 @Override public void afterTextChanged(Editable s) { // TODO Auto-generated method